11/09/2017 - Baseball Factory Select Training & Competition at Pirate City (Ages 14-18) Adam is a coachable player who can make adjustments quickly. On the mound, this lefty is aggressive, filling up the zone with strikes and challenging hitters to swing the bat. He maintains good tempo and works at his pace. FB tops out at 73 mph while showing some sinking action. Changeup is thrown with FB arm speed helping to create deception. Curveball shows to be his best pitch with 1/7 shape as he can throw it for strikes in any count. He has a solid pick-off move with quick footwork and keeps runners close. In the OF, Adam takes good angles to work into position behind the fly-ball. He secures the ball with 2-hands and has a clean exchange to throw. Gaining more ground with a crow-hop will help to get more into his throws. As a hitter, Adam displays a tall stance with a good load. He swings against a firm front side, connects and creates good extension through contact. Working to swing on a shorter/more direct path with more bat speed will help to increase power. Adam has a solid all-around skill-set that should provide success in this his junior year. He will toe the rubber, throw strikes and give his team a chance every time his number is called.
